Falls are one of the leading causes of injury among older adults, but many falls can be prevented with the right care. Fall prevention therapy focuses on improving balance, strength, flexibility, coordination, and walking ability to reduce the risk of falls and help individuals remain safe and independent.

Fall prevention therapy is a specialized physical therapy program that improves balance, strength, coordination, and walking ability to reduce the risk of falls and promote safe, independent mobility.
Older adults can reduce their risk of falls by participating in a structured fall prevention program, improving strength and balance, using proper footwear, removing home hazards, and attending regular physical therapy when balance or walking problems are present.
Balance training includes exercises that improve stability, coordination, posture, and body control, helping individuals move safely and confidently.
Gait training focuses on improving walking mechanics, posture, step length, and movement patterns to make walking safer and more efficient.
Older adults, individuals with neurological conditions, balance disorders, muscle weakness, dizziness, recent surgeries, or a history of falls can all benefit from a personalized fall prevention therapy program.
